What Are Fontanels?
Fontanels, commonly referred to as "soft spots," are fibrous membrane-covered gaps between the cranial bones of a newborn's skull. Unlike the rigid, fused bones of an adult skull, an infant's skull bones are not yet fully joined together. Instead, they are separated by these flexible, membranous regions that allow the skull to be pliable and adaptable during the earliest stages of life.
A newborn typically has two primary fontanels:
- Anterior fontanel — located at the top front of the skull; diamond-shaped and the largest of the fontanels.
- Posterior fontanel — located at the back of the head; smaller and triangular in shape.
On top of that, there are several smaller fontanels (mastoid and sphenoidal), but the anterior and posterior are the most clinically significant Still holds up..

✅ Correct Statement: Fontanels Allow for Rapid Brain Growth During Infancy
One of the most important functions of fontanels is to accommodate the rapid expansion of the brain during the first year of life. A newborn's brain is approximately 25% of its adult size, and by the age of two, it reaches roughly 75% of its adult size. The fontanels provide flexible "expansion joints" in the skull, ensuring that the growing brain is not constrained by rigid bone Most people skip this — try not to. Turns out it matters..
✅ Correct Statement: Fontanels help with Compression During Childbirth
During vaginal delivery, the baby's head must pass through the narrow birth canal. Here's the thing — the fontanels allow the skull bones to overlap and compress slightly, reducing the head's diameter and making the passage through the birth canal safer and smoother. This process, sometimes called "molding," is made possible entirely by the flexibility that fontanels provide. After birth, the skull gradually returns to its normal shape It's one of those things that adds up..
✅ Correct Statement: Fontanels Serve as Clinical Indicators of a Child's Health
Pediatricians routinely examine fontanels as part of a routine physical assessment of infants. The condition of the fontanel can reveal critical information:
- A bulging or tense fontanel may indicate increased intracranial pressure, potentially caused by conditions such as hydrocephalus, meningitis, or other neurological disorders.
- A sunken or depressed fontanel is often a sign of dehydration or malnutrition.
- A flat, soft fontanel is considered normal and healthy.
This makes fontanels an invaluable, non-invasive diagnostic tool in pediatric medicine.
❌ Incorrect Statement: Fontanels Are Fully Formed Bones That Protect the Brain
This statement is inaccurate. On the flip side, fontanels are not bones — they are membranous gaps. Worth adding: it is the bony plates surrounding the fontanels (connected by fibrous tissue called sutures) that provide structural protection. The fontanels themselves are soft and vulnerable, which is why caregivers are always advised to handle an infant's head with care.
❌ Incorrect Statement: Fontanels Have No Purpose and Close Immediately After Birth
This is also false. Because of that, fontanels serve several critical functions, as outlined above, and they do not close immediately. The posterior fontanel typically closes by 2 to 3 months of age, while the anterior fontanel closes much later, usually between 12 and 18 months (and in some cases, as late as 24 months).
The Timeline of Fontanel Closure
Understanding when fontanels close is just as important as understanding their functions. Here is a general timeline:
| Fontanel | Location | Shape | Typical Closure Age |
|---|---|---|---|
| Anterior | Top front of skull | Diamond-shaped | 12–18 months (up to 24 months) |
| Posterior | Back of the head | Triangular | 2–3 months |
| Mastoid | Behind the ear | Small, irregular | 6–18 months |
| Sphenoidal | Side of the head | Small, irregular | 6–18 months |
Delayed closure of the anterior fontanel (beyond 18–24 months) may indicate underlying conditions such as rickets, hypothyroidism, Down syndrome, or hydrocephalus. Conversely, early closure (craniosynostosis) can restrict brain growth and may require surgical intervention Surprisingly effective..
The Science Behind Fontanels: How They Work
From a biological perspective, fontanels are formed where multiple cranial bones meet but have not yet fused. Day to day, the bones of the skull develop through a process called intramembranous ossification, in which fibrous membranes gradually convert into bone tissue. Fontanels represent areas where this ossification process has not yet been completed.
The sutures — the fibrous joints between the skull bones — work in tandem with the fontanels. Together, they create a flexible framework that:
- Supports brain expansion without creating dangerous pressure inside the skull.
- Absorbs mechanical shock, providing a degree of protection against minor impacts.
- Enables cranial remodeling during birth and early growth.
This remarkable design reflects the extraordinary pace of neurological development that occurs in human infants during their first two years of life Most people skip this — try not to..

When to Seek Medical Attention
While most fontanel changes are normal, certain symptoms warrant immediate medical care:
- A bulging fontanel (especially when the baby is calm and upright) may indicate increased pressure inside the skull, which can result from infection, hydrocephalus, or other serious conditions.
- A sunken fontanel often signals dehydration, particularly if accompanied by fewer wet diapers, dry mouth, or lethargy.
- A fontanel that closes much earlier than expected (before 9 months) could suggest craniosynostosis, a condition where skull sutures fuse prematurely, potentially limiting brain growth.
- A fontanel that remains excessively large or fails to close after age 2 may point to hormonal disorders, genetic syndromes, or nutritional deficiencies like rickets.
Regular pediatric checkups are essential, as the doctor will measure head circumference and assess fontanel health as part of routine developmental surveillance Easy to understand, harder to ignore..
